The proposed mechanism of action for its mood stabilization and neurogenenerative effects are due to the inhibition of glycogen synthase kinase-3B (GSK-3B). 2 Lithium also upregulates insulin-like growth factor-1 (IGF-1), and brain-derived … WebNeurological side effects of lithium. At therapeutic levels, lithium can cause a persistent fine hand tremor, muscle weakness and rarely, extrapyramidal features. Tremors may be treated with a beta-blocker. Patients with lithium toxicity may have impaired consciousness, apathy, hyperreflexia, hypertonia, seizures and rarely, death.

WebJun 21, 2024 · In a 28-day, repeated-dose oral toxicity study, rats were administered 0, 100, 200, or 400 mg/kg body weight/day of lithium orotate by gavage. No toxicity or target organs were identified; therefore, a no observed adverse effect level was determined as 400 mg/kg body weight/day.
